Patent number: 12134914Abstract: A lock knob attachment includes an attachment portion configured to be attached to a lock bar that is configured to lock a door by sliding in a first direction, and a main body portion configured to be coupled to the attachment portion and configured to extend from the attachment portion to a second direction perpendicular to the first direction. When a direction perpendicular to both the first direction and the second direction is defined as a third direction, a length of the main body portion in a direction along the third direction is greater than a length of the attachment portion in a direction along the third direction.Type: GrantFiled: March 15, 2021Date of Patent: November 5, 2024Assignee: JAMCO CORPORATIONInventors: Hisaya Hagiwara, Sachiko Fukutomi

Patent number: 11939062Abstract: Provided is an Aircraft Lavatory Unit 20 that ensures lavatory user comfort while facilitating diaper changing. The Aircraft Lavatory Unit 20 includes a Diaper Changing Table 10 on which an infant can be placed and which can be selectively changed between a Housed State in which the Diaper Changing Table 10 is housed in a Wall Surface and a Pulled-Out State in which the Diaper Changing Table 10 is pulled out from the Wall Surface; and a display 25 which is disposed to face the Diaper Changing Table 10 in the Pulled-Out State and display still images or videos.Type: GrantFiled: March 27, 2020Date of Patent: March 26, 2024Assignee: JAMCO CORPORATIONInventors: Hisaya Hagiwara, Sachiko Fukutomi, Robert Keiichi Nakamoto

Patent number: 11859405Abstract: The handle attachment includes a base portion that can be attached to a portion of a wall surface of a door, a flap portion that applies, as a result of a pulling operation, a pulling force to the door via the base portion, a flap rotation mechanism that rotatably connects the flap portion with respect to the base portion around a rotation axis, and a biasing member that biases the flap portion in a first rotation direction around the rotation axis with respect to the base portion. The flap portion includes a base end portion connected to the flap rotation mechanism and a distal end portion arranged at a position away from the flap rotation mechanism. The first rotation direction is a direction in which the distal end portion of the flap portion separates from the wall surface of the door.Type: GrantFiled: March 15, 2021Date of Patent: January 2, 2024Assignee: JAMCO CORPORATIONInventors: Hisaya Hagiwara, Sachiko Fukutomi

Patent number: 11731764Abstract: Provided is an aircraft seat structure capable of ensuring passenger comfort and effectively utilizing space in the cabin. The aircraft seat structure includes a first seat unit having a first seat region in which passengers are able to sit, and a first side region adjacent in a direction perpendicular to a longitudinal direction of the first seat region; and a second seat unit having a second seat region in which passengers are able to sit, and a second side region adjacent in a direction perpendicular to a longitudinal direction of the second seat region. The first side region is provided on one side of the first seat region along a direction that intersects a traveling direction of an aircraft, and the second side region is provided on another side of the second seat region along the direction that intersects the traveling direction of the aircraft. The first side region and the second seat region are joined in a state in which a portion of the second seat region is inserted into the first side region.Type: GrantFiled: March 13, 2020Date of Patent: August 22, 2023Assignee: JAMCO CORPORATIONInventors: Sachiko Katakura, Hisaya Hagiwara, Rei Kigoshi

Patent number: 11655034Abstract: The aircraft seat unit includes a first seat 13, a second seat 14, an intermediate portion 15 disposed between the first seat 13 and the second seat 14, and a front wall 11 adjacent to the intermediate portion 15. An axis line X1 of the first seat 13 and an axis line X2 of the second seat 14 are respectively disposed at angles that are oriented in mutually opposite directions with respect to a traveling direction. The intermediate portion 15 is disposed in a space between the first set and the second seat and is capable of supporting a load of a bassinet 30 placed thereon. The front wall 11 includes engagement holes 11e that detachably engage with engagement portions 32 of the bassinet 30.Type: GrantFiled: June 12, 2018Date of Patent: May 23, 2023Assignee: JAMCO CORPORATIONInventors: Sachiko Katakura, Hisaya Hagiwara, Ken Kimizuka, Rei Kigoshi, Michio Kinoshita, Manabu Matsumoto, Amon Igari, Yuichi Akutsu

Publication number: 20210009271Abstract: A seat unit for an aircraft includes an intermediate portion disposed between a first seat and a second seat. In a bed state, the intermediate portion is adjacent to a first backrest and a second backrest while a height of an upper surface of the intermediate portion substantially coincides with the height of the first backrest and the second backrest. The intermediate portion includes a vertically movable partition plate. In a state in which the partition plate is housed in the intermediate portion, the upper end of the partition plate is located at or below the height of the upper surface of the intermediate portion, and when the partition plate is raised, the upper end of the partition plate can move to a position above the eye level of a user seated on a at least a first seating portion or a second seating portion in a seat state.Type: ApplicationFiled: March 27, 2018Publication date: January 14, 2021Inventors: Sachiko KATAKURA, Hisaya HAGIWARA, Michio KINOSHITA, Manabu MATSUMOTO, Amon IGARI, Yuichi AKUTSU

Publication number: 20190029540Abstract: A measurement apparatus includes an insertion portion insertable in an external ear canal, a pressing portion that presses a concha when the insertion portion is inserted in the external ear canal, a contact portion that comes into contact with a tragus to clamp the tragus when the concha is pressed by the pressing portion, a sensor that is mounted on the contact portion and acquires biological measurement output at the tragus when the contact portion is in contact with the tragus, and a controller that measures biological information on the basis of the biological measurement output acquired by the sensor.Type: ApplicationFiled: September 21, 2016Publication date: January 31, 2019Inventors: Tetsuya NEGISHI, Osamu TOCHIKUBO, Hisaya HAGIWARA
